I appreciate the answer. Can you elaborate a bit more as I am not quite sure what you mean (again, I was mostly following on gametracker).

I forget the exact scenario, but I think it was Underwood on the mound and we had Barfield and somebody else in the pen warming up. Ramsey went for a mound visit to set the defense and was pointing around the infield while discussing what he wanted to happen. Next thing you know Barfield is jogging onto the field and Ramsey looks confused and asks what’s going on. Ump says you asked for a pitching change. Ramsey said no I did not. They argued for 2 minutes and ump said they already checked Barfield into the game. Replay showed that Ramsey did nothing that could be interpreted as calling for a pitching change by any ump that was paying attention. So we were forced to make a pitching change that we didn’t intend to make.
